A Guide to Selecting the Best Portable Pizza Oven
Choosing the right portable pizza oven can greatly enhance your outdoor cooking experience. Whether you're a pizza enthusiast or just love the idea of making fresh, homemade pizzas on the go, there are several key specifications to consider. Understanding these specs will help you find the best fit for your needs and ensure you get the most out of your portable pizza oven.
Fuel Type
The fuel type of a portable pizza oven determines how it is powered and can affect the flavor and convenience of cooking. Common fuel types include wood, gas, and charcoal. Wood-fired ovens offer a traditional flavor and high heat, but require more effort to manage. Gas ovens are convenient and easy to control, making them ideal for quick cooking. Charcoal ovens provide a smoky flavor and are versatile for different cooking styles. Choose a fuel type based on your preference for flavor, ease of use, and cooking style.
Size and Portability
Size and portability are crucial for a portable pizza oven, as they determine how easy it is to transport and store. Smaller ovens are lightweight and easy to carry, making them perfect for camping or tailgating. Larger ovens may offer more cooking space but can be heavier and less convenient to move. Consider how often you plan to transport the oven and the available space you have for storage when choosing the right size.
Cooking Surface
The cooking surface of a portable pizza oven affects the size and number of pizzas you can cook at once. A larger cooking surface allows you to cook multiple pizzas or larger pizzas, while a smaller surface is suitable for individual or small-sized pizzas. Think about your typical cooking needs and how many people you usually cook for to determine the appropriate cooking surface size.
Temperature Range
The temperature range of a portable pizza oven is important for achieving the perfect pizza crust. Higher temperatures (around 700-900°F) are ideal for Neapolitan-style pizzas with a crispy, charred crust. Lower temperatures (500-600°F) are suitable for thicker crusts and other types of baking. Consider the type of pizzas you prefer and ensure the oven can reach the necessary temperatures for your desired cooking style.
Material and Build Quality
The material and build quality of a portable pizza oven affect its durability and heat retention. Stainless steel and ceramic are common materials that offer good heat retention and durability. Look for ovens with sturdy construction and high-quality materials to ensure they can withstand frequent use and outdoor conditions. Choose a well-built oven to ensure longevity and consistent cooking performance.
Ease of Use and Cleaning
Ease of use and cleaning are important for maintaining your portable pizza oven and ensuring a hassle-free cooking experience. Features like easy ignition, adjustable temperature controls, and removable parts can make the oven more user-friendly. Additionally, consider how easy it is to clean the oven after use, as some models have removable trays or non-stick surfaces that simplify cleaning. Choose an oven that offers convenience in both operation and maintenance.
